What they do

A Logistics Coordinator coordinates processing and distribution of supplies, equipment or materials for a company or organization. Develops order schedules, tracks shipments and deliveries, cultivates relationships with suppliers, monitors supply quality; may supervise warehouse operations and staff.

Job Description

Overview Join our dynamic youth development teams in as a vital member dedicated to fostering positive growth and enriching experiences for young people. We are seeking energetic and motivated individuals to fill roles including Membership Coordinators, 21st Site Coordinators, and Bus Drivers. These paid positions offer the opportunity to make a meaningful impact by guiding youth through engaging activities, ensuring safe transportation, and supporting community programs. If you are passionate about youth development, possess strong leadership skills, and enjoy working with children, this is your chance to contribute to a vibrant team committed to empowering the next generation. Duties Coordinate and facilitate youth group activities, ensuring engaging and age-appropriate programming that promotes personal growth and community involvement Manage membership records, assist with registration processes, and maintain accurate documentation of participant participation Supervise children during activities, ensuring their safety through effective child supervision and behavior management strategies Operate school buses or transportation vehicles safely, adhering to all safety protocols including
CPR, AED
operation, first aid procedures, and transportation regulations Support outdoor work activities and camp experiences by setting up equipment, supervising outdoor games, and ensuring a safe environment for all participants Collaborate with team members to plan and implement youth development programs that align with educational standards and community needs Provide first aid or emergency assistance as needed, following established protocols to ensure the well-being of children and staff Requirements Experience working with children in settings such as daycare, babysitting, camp leadership, or youth programs Knowledge of childhood development principles and behavior management techniques Valid driver's license with a clean driving record; experience operating buses or large vehicles preferred Certifications in CPR, First Aid, AED operation, and First Aid protocols required; willingness to obtain or renew certifications if necessary Strong classroom management skills combined with patience and positive reinforcement strategies Ability to work outdoors in various weather conditions and handle outdoor activity logistics effectively Previous experience in youth group activity facilitation or teaching young children is highly desirable Join us in creating a safe, supportive environment where young people can thrive! This paid role offers meaningful work that combines leadership, education, safety expertise, and community engagement—all essential ingredients for inspiring future leaders.
